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15303257 98053639239 542 001122 4969725680
2650 88069
2650 88069
40 621558892 5244577
All about undefined
Interested in learning more?
2650 88069
40 621558892 5244577
See more
85507 3225716
796 5544 4492014 669219536 81
See more
911 08
2398 2698 3187 66504
See more